Medallion Financial ( (MFIN) ) has shared an update.
On February 26, 2026, Medallion Financial Corp. repaid at maturity the full $31.25 million aggregate principal amount of its privately placed notes. The retirement of this debt reduces the company’s outstanding obligations and may improve balance sheet flexibility and capital structure for future financing needs.
The repayment underscores Medallion Financial’s ability to meet its scheduled debt commitments, which may be viewed positively by creditors and investors assessing its credit profile. By extinguishing this tranche of privately placed notes on time, the company potentially lowers interest expense and enhances its financial positioning in the specialty finance market.

More about Medallion Financial
Medallion Financial Corp. is a specialty finance company that provides lending and financial services, traditionally focused on niche credit markets such as consumer and commercial lending. The company raises capital through various debt instruments, including privately placed notes, to fund its loan portfolio and manage its balance sheet.
